Problem 1 – 15 pts Air enters the compressor of a Brayton cycle with a mass flow rate of 100 kg/s at 300 K. The compressor pressure ratio is 15.75, and the maximum cycle temperature is 2000 K. For the compressor, the isentropic efficiency is 92%, and for the turbine the isentropic efficiency is 95%. (a) 8 pts – On an air-standard basis, determine the work input for the compressor (MW) (b) 7 pts – On a cold air-standard basis, determine the work output for the turbine (MW)
